Hi! I'm Diego, a Mechanical Engineering student with a passion for mathematics and helping others succeed. I've always enjoyed breaking down difficult concepts into simple, understandable steps, and there's nothing more rewarding than seeing a student gain confidence and solve problems independently.
My tutoring experience began in high school, where I volunteered through TPA tutoring fourth and fifth grade students in both math and English. In college, I continued helping classmates in Pre-Calculus and Calculus, often attending different discussion sections to answer questions and work through homework problems together. I also create educational videos explaining engineering and math concepts, which has strengthened my ability to communicate clearly and teach step by step.
My teaching style is patient, interactive, and personalized. Rather than having students memorize formulas, I focus on helping them understand the reasoning behind each concept so they can confidently solve new problems on their own. I encourage questions throughout every lesson and adapt my explanations to each student's learning style and pace.
A typical lesson begins by identifying the topics the student finds most challenging. We review the underlying concepts, work through examples together step by step, and then practice similar problems independently to reinforce understanding. I also share study strategies and problem-solving techniques that students can use long after our sessions.
I offer lessons for elementary, middle school, and high school students, as well as college students taking Pre-Algebra, Algebra, Geometry, Trigonometry, Pre-Calculus, Calculus, introductory engineering mathematics, Physics I (Mechanics), and Thermodynamics. For Physics I, I can help with vectors, kinematics, Newton's laws of motion, free-body diagrams, friction, work and energy, conservation of energy, momentum and impulse, collisions, rotational motion, torque, angular momentum, oscillations, and gravitation. For Thermodynamics, I can help with energy balances, the First and Second Laws of Thermodynamics, properties of pure substances, control volumes, entropy, power and refrigeration cycles, and solving engineering thermodynamics problems step by step.
